Transaction 0753fc410ccad09ec5c658e98220692e08848044d05cd75f18b3310e63a1599e

1 Input
2 Outputs
  • 0753fc410ccad09ec5c658e98220692e08848044d05cd75f18b3310e63a1599e:0
  • value  4445505
    address  16yvPNxfnay8j8f7ejWxHpgQ1HGSwS6YZc
  • 0753fc410ccad09ec5c658e98220692e08848044d05cd75f18b3310e63a1599e:1
  • value  10273372
    address  1FQv2KMxVHLAfvpe3udFstvqctdnbsD3Jr